We'll take a shot at both late Pick four's, although they do look to be a little bit on the chaky side.

Aqueduct - Race 6 - G2 Demoiselle

I can honestly make a case for each filly. ALL

Race 7 - G2 Remsen

#2 Nobiz like Shobiz - Talented Tagg runner ran very game in the G1 Champagne despite having trouble leaving the gate. Single.

Race 8 - G1 Cigar Mile

#4 Discreet Cat - Has been tremendously good since stepping foot on a race track. Undefeated Goldophin runner looks to capture 1st Grade 1. He's simply made mincemeat out of his competition. Logical.

Race 9

#8 Lost Going Home - Contessa stretches out gelding after an easy victory in his debut.

#10 Starhumor - Levine/Coa looking for a better break and some speed up front to run at.

PK4 - All with 2 with 4 with 8 10 = $18 for a buck. I suggest you punch it a few times.
